The Western Conference clash between the Portland Timbers and Vancouver Whitecaps is set to take place in Vancouver, British Columbia. The matchup will feature two teams that are currently struggling to find their footing in the standings. The Timbers are currently 2-2-1 this season, while the Whitecaps are 2-1-1.
As the game approaches, Fanduel Sportsbook has released its MLS line, with Vancouver favored at -122 and Portland at +296. A draw is also an option at +283. Both teams will be looking to secure a win and claim important points in the standings.
Last season, both teams struggled to find success on the field. The Whitecaps finished with a record of 12-10-12 overall and a home record of 8-4-6. They averaged just 1.6 goals and 4.5 shots on goal per game. On the other hand, the Timbers finished last season with a record of 11-13-10 overall and a road record of 2-8-7. They scored just 46 goals while allowing opponents to score 58.
Despite these struggles, both teams have some key players who could make a difference in this matchup. Sam Adekugbe is expected to miss out for Vancouver, while Claudio Bravo and Marvin Loria are not expected to play for Portland.
